SafeTouch Security was founded in 1988 and has offices in Jacksonville, Tampa Bay, and Orlando, Florida. The company has an office in Savannah, Georgia as well. While more transparent with many aspects of its pricing, there are still significant improvements needed to the company's transparency in terms of its service contracts.

SafeTouch Security has served areas around Orlando, Tampa Bay, and Jacksonville, Florida, with another office in Savannah, Georgia. The company offers its customers home security systems and home automation products with monthly monitoring. Customers can control their system with a mobile device using the Alarm.com app or from any internet browser. Distinctive from other companies, SafeTouch Security offers customers transparency on its pricing, but only to a degree. There remain voids of information that is offered by other companies.

In spite of publishing some of its prices, customers must dig for information. Highly unusual is the company's policy of posting prices for its packages on Facebook, rather than on its website. Adding to the lack of transparency is that the company does not publish information about its service contract online. There are many reports from customers which state that the company has multiple hidden terms in its service contract, with an auto renewal for all contracts, hefty cancellation fees, and that the company requires at least 30 days notice to cancel the contract at the end of the term. Customers are supposedly required to submit the request for cancellation in the form of a certified letter, according to multiple reports. Without sample contracts published by SafeTouch online, these anecdotal reports cannot be substantiated or disproven.

SafeTouch Security has many features that customers would find attractive. Those with an existing security system that is not under a monitoring contract can subscribe to the company's monitoring service. There remains adequate concern about the company's lack of transparency about its contract and odd practice of publishing pricing on its social media pages exclusively for BestCompany.com to suggest caution to customers before entering into a long-term contract without fully understanding the entire contract.
